Cracked Glass

A lawnmowers' pebble or a torrential downpour or even a ball for a child can cause cracks to appear in the window. Fortunately, if you spot cracks in the window early, they're relatively easy to repair yourself. If the cracks are so large that they could cause the glass to break at any moment, you should contact an expert.

You have two options when it comes to replacing doors and windows for repairs: either a temporary fix using putty and resin, or Repair My Windows And Doors a more comprehensive repair that requires the replacement of glass and window panes. The former may be better suited to your needs and your budget, depending on the specifics of your situation.

You'll need two-part epoxy to fix small cracks on the window. The epoxy is composed of two components comprising a resin and a hardener. They must be mixed to work. You'll also require a knife to apply the epoxy. These supplies can be purchased online or in a hardware shop. The epoxy is usually stored in a double cylinder Syringe that regulates the flow and keeps the proper ratio.

Before applying the epoxy, ensure that the crack is clean and dry. Then, carefully press the epoxy over the crack and into it with your putty knife. After a few minutes, the epoxy will be hardened and it will be more difficult to see any cracks. To remove any excess epoxy, you will need to wipe it with acetone-soaked paper.

Some companies claim that a damaged crack is virtually undetectable, but this isn't always the case. Even a crack that has been fully repaired is often still visible, particularly if the crack was previously very deep or large. It is important to prevent the crack from growing, so be sure to act fast.

Sagging Frame

It can be difficult to open or close frames that are sliding. They can also scrape against the jambs of doors. This can cause your uPVC doors to appear shabby or damaged and leave marks on the door. Luckily, there are quick ways to fix the issue.

The most common reason for sagging is loose or worn screws in the top hinge. Alternatively, older homes often have a single heavy door that is supported by only one hinge. In most cases it is fixed by tightening the hinge screws on top or replacing them with larger screws that have a coarser thread.

If the problem is caused by the spacer or shim, it can be removed by removing the hinge. You can then easily take the shim off and throw it away. It could be a thin piece of cardboard or metal that was added to either hinge leaf to enable the door to fit into the frame more securely. Sometimes, a shim may become lodged under the hinge so that you cannot see it.

Broken Hinges

The majority of homes in the UK uses upvc window repairs or aluminum windows that open with hinges. If you see gaps, drafts or difficulties opening your window It could be a sign that the hinges have deteriorated and require replacement.

A faulty window hinge can cost you between $75 and $200 if it must be replaced by a professional. The price depends on the type of window hinge and how many hinges you need to Repair My Windows And Doors. Repairing tilt and turn windows is more expensive than fixing simple side opening uPVC windows or aluminium windows.

The hinge consists of a sleeve and knuckle. The sleeve is the circular section that surrounds the pin, holding it in place. The knuckle or the centre of the hinge, is the one responsible for its movement. The pin is a solid rod with a cylindrical shape that runs through the knuckle to connect the two leaves.

It's simple to prevent window hinges from breaking by carrying out regular maintenance. This includes cleaning the surface of friction and regularly lubricating the metal parts and Repair My Windows And Doors removing dirt. This will allow the hinges to perform better and last longer.

Draughts

Double-glazed doors and windows offer homeowners the highest quality and energy efficiency. However, they can also develop various issues over time that affect their functionality and appearance. Most often, these issues are the result of poor maintenance and incorrect installation of the window or door components. Homeowners can prevent costly repairs by following the appropriate maintenance and contacting a certified window repair service. A reputable business can guarantee that your double glazing products are installed correctly and are backed by their guarantee certificates and insurers.

The presence of drafts in your home could cause significant energy loss and high heating bills. Fortunately they can be easily repaired by professionals who are well-versed in the correct techniques and materials to employ. They can also install new draught seals to enhance the performance and efficiency of the door or window. The main function of a draught seal is to reduce air leakage around the frame, improving security and comfort. Additionally, a low-friction seal can reduce noises that rattle and reduces the flow of pollutants in the air.

A draughty window or door could also be the result of broken hinges, misaligned hinges panes or locks that aren't working properly. A professional will be able determine the issue and suggest the most effective solution. In some cases hinges or locks may need to be replaced. If this is the situation, a professional will replace them easily and cheaply.
